接口及参数描述的 JSON 字符串
JSON 字符串连麦参数,roomId 代表目标房间号,userId 代表目标用户 ID。
决定了 onUserVoiceVolume 回调的触发间隔,单位为ms,最小间隔为100ms,如果小于等于0则会关闭回调,建议设置为300ms;详细的回调规则请参考 onUserVoiceVolume 的注释说明
应用场景,目前支持视频通话(VideoCall)、在线直播(Live)、语音通话(AudioCall)、语音聊天室(VoiceChatRoom)四种场景。
获取 SDK 采集音量。
TXAudioEffectManager
获取 SDK 播放音量
TXBeautyManager
TXDeviceManager
版本号信息
true:静音;false:取消静音
是否暂停接收
true:静音;false:取消静音
对方的用户 ID
true:静音;false:取消静音
指定远端用户的 ID。
是否暂停接收。
添加事件
音量大小,取值0 - 100
音量大小,取值0 - 100
指定是否启用,默认为禁止状态
true:自动接收音频数据;false:需要调用 muteRemoteAudio 进行请求或取消。默认值:true。autoRecvVideo true:自动接收视频数据;false:需要调用 startRemoteView/stopRemoteView 进行请求或取消。默认值:true。注意:需要在进房前设置才能生效。
指定是否启用,默认为启用状态
存储日志路径
请参见 TRTC_LOG_LEVEL,默认值:TRTCCloudDef.TRTC_LOG_LEVEL_NULL
远程用户 ID
true:镜像;false:不镜像;默认值:false
用于设置视频编码器的相关参数,详情请参考 TRTCVideoEncParam。
目前支持0和180两个旋转角度,默认值:TRTCVideoRotation_0,即不旋转。
0:成功;-1:录音已开始;-2:文件或目录创建失败;-3:后缀指定的音频格式不支持; -1001:参数错误
声音音质
自定义流 ID。
仅支持 TRTCCloudDef.TRTC_VIDEO_STREAM_TYPE_BIG 和 TRTCCloudDef.TRTC_VIDEO_STREAM_TYPE_SUB。
应用标识
用户标识
用户签名
停止向非腾讯云地址转推
停止向腾讯云的直播 CDN 推流
停止服务器测速。
目标角色,默认为主播:TRTCCloudDef.TRTCRoleAnchor 主播,可以上行视频和音频,一个房间里最多支持50个主播同时上行音视频。TRTCCloudDef.TRTCRoleAudience 观众,只能观看,不能上行视频和音频,一个房间里的观众人数没有上限。
房间参数,详情请参考 TRTCSwitchRoomConfig
移除所有事件
移除事件
销毁 TRTCCloud 单例。
创建 TRTCCloud 单例。
Generated using TypeDoc